TAIPING BUSINESS CENTRE, Tupai, Larut Matang, Perak, Malaysia

Taiping Business Centre in Larut Matang, Perak recorded 4 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, sized between 2,625 and 2,674 sqft, with a median price of RM 713K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 268.

This area consists exclusively of commercial properties, with no residential list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 713K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 645K to RM 780K, and a typical market range of RM 609K to RM 788K.

Most transactions involved 2 - 2 1/2 storey shop, though some variety exists in the market.

For price per square foot, the median is RM 268, with most transactions between RM 243 and RM 293. The usual range is RM 183.99 to RM 351.99,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. With an IQR of RM 168.00 and MAD of RM 25,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
